// Config hot-reloading for the Brindlemere client.
// The watcher polls /etc/brindlemere/client.toml every 15s and applies
// changes without a restart. Connection pool size, retry budgets, and
// timeout values are all reloadable; endpoint URLs are not, by design,
// since swapping hosts mid-flight corrupted the session cache in the
// 3.2 release. Reload events are logged at INFO so the release manager
// can confirm rollout without shelling in. The client authenticates to
// the internal Fennic registry with the key that follows.

app token of tageg-kadug = vxb2-26

**Ticket: Config drift on shrinkly batch hosts**

Heads up for the sync — the shrinkly resize CLI is behaving differently on batch-07 vs. the rest. Turns out someone hand-edited the worker config back in spring and it never got reconciled. Output JPEG quality and max concurrency don't match the fleet, so thumbnails from that host look off. Marit is baking a fix. For reference, here's what batch-07 is currently running with.

deployment values, fajog-fajog:
zorael:
  log_level: info
  metrics_host: metrics.zorael.lumicsys.internal
  pool_size: 16

Hi Soren,

Welcome to the Verdanta on-call rotation. The watering scheduler runs cron-style jobs per greenhouse zone; missed runs retry twice, then page. When reviewing fixes, check that zone locks are released on failure — that's bitten us before. Moisture sensor calibration drifts weekly, so ignore minor threshold alerts. The full runbook lives on the internal page here.

wiki page, bawef-hafop: https://jira.nelvroworks.corp/job/pages/projects/7c5c0f440dbd